Webpack高级 14 -- Cache 缓存

77 阅读1分钟

1 . Why?

每次打包 js 文件时都要经过 Eslint 检查(代码格式)和 Babel 编译(处理兼容性),速度比较慢。

我们可以缓存之前的 Eslint 检查和 Babel 编译结果,这样第二(三...)次打包时速度就会快许多!!!

2 . 是什么?

Cache 就是对第一次 Eslint 检查和 Babel 编译的结果进行缓存。

3 . How ?

  • Babel的配置:

1080.png

  • Eslint的配置:

1081.png